The National Assembly spent 2.5 days questioning 3 Ministers and the State Auditor General on 4 areas: natural resources and environment; industry and trade; culture, sports, tourism and state audit; Deputy Prime Ministers and members of the Government also participated in answering questions. The National Assembly gave opinions on the content to issue a Resolution on questioning and answering questions at the 7th Session of the 15th National Assembly.
The National Assembly Chairman said that with a high approval rate, the National Assembly voted to pass 11 laws including: Law on Archives; Law on Organization of People's Courts; Law on Social Insurance; Law on National Defense Industry, Security and Industrial Mobilization; Law on Roads; Law on Road Traffic Order and Safety; Law on Capital; Law on amending and supplementing a number of articles of the Law on Property Auction; Law on amending and supplementing a number of articles of the Law on Guards; Law on Management and Use of Weapons, Explosives and Supporting Tools; Law on amending and supplementing a number of articles of the Law on Land, the Law on Housing, the Law on Real Estate Business, and the Law on Credit Institutions.
The National Assembly reviewed and approved 21 resolutions, including 3 legal resolutions: Resolution on piloting the addition of a number of specific mechanisms and policies for the development of Nghe An province; Resolution on organizing urban government and piloting a number of specific mechanisms and policies for the development of Da Nang city; Resolution on the 2025 Law and Ordinance Development Program, adjusting the 2024 Law and Ordinance Development Program.
The National Assembly reviewed and approved the Resolution on the National Assembly's Supervision Program for 2025 and the General Resolution of the Session. The National Assembly gave its initial opinions on 11 draft laws; reviewed the supplementary assessment report on the results of the implementation of the socio-economic development plan and the state budget for 2023 and the implementation in the first months of 2024; approved the 2022 state budget settlement and gave opinions on a number of other important contents.

At the closing session, with 472/473 delegates participating in the vote in favor (accounting for 97.12% of the total number of National Assembly delegates), the National Assembly passed the Resolution on questioning activities at the 7th Session, 15th National Assembly.
The National Assembly also passed the Resolution of the 7th Session, 15th National Assembly with 460/460 delegates participating in the vote in favor.
The Resolution of the 7th Session clearly stated that the National Assembly agreed to implement the contents of salary reform; adjust pensions, social insurance benefits, preferential benefits for people with meritorious services and social benefits from July 1, 2024.
Specifically, from July 1, 2024, the basic salary will be adjusted from VND 1.8 million/month to VND 2.34 million/month (an increase of 30%); the current pension and social insurance allowance will be adjusted up by 15% (June 2024); for those receiving pensions before 1995, if after adjustment the benefit is lower than VND 3.2 million/month, it will be adjusted up by VND 300,000/month, if the benefit is from VND 3.2 million/month to less than VND 3.5 million/month, it will be adjusted to be equal to VND 3.5 million/month.
In addition, the preferential allowance for meritorious people will be adjusted according to the standard allowance level from VND 2,055,000 to VND 2,789,000/month (an increase of 35.7%), maintaining the current correlation between the preferential allowance levels for meritorious people and the standard allowance level; adjusting social allowance according to the standard social assistance level from VND 360,000 to VND 500,000/month (an increase of 38.9%).
